History of the FSE Program
  • Closure of the San Francisco College of Mortuary
    Science June 2002
  • ARCs Initial Accreditation October 2002
  • Five Years
  • 1 of 2 in California
  • 1 of 57 in the United States
  • First FSE100 class Fall 2002
  • First cohort of program students Spring 2003
  • Full-time Coordinator Spring 2003
  • Second full-time faculty member Fall 2004

Curriculum
  • Online Course
  • FSE100 (Introduction to Funeral Service
    Education)
  • New Course
  • FSE1000 (California Embalmers Review Course)
  • New Curriculum Updates for FSE 111, FSE150,
    FSE155, and FSE170 from the ABFSE
